SkyJumper expands nationwide footprint with 22nd centre in Mohali

The new facility is spread across 22,000 sq ft

SkyJumper, India’s leading chain of indoor amusement and adventure parks, has launched its 22nd centre in Mohali, further strengthening its nationwide footprint and reaffirming its leadership in the active entertainment sector. Spread across 22,000 sq ft, the new facility brings together trampolines, North India’s largest VR Arena, Hypergrid, laser war and spy games, a kids’ play area, café, and dedicated party halls—making it the ultimate family destination for play, celebrations and immersive experiences.

According to a press release, Suneel Dhar, Co-Founder of SkyJumper, said, “Punjab has always had an incredible appetite for recreation, and with four centres already in the region, Mohali now gets its own dedicated hub. Our vision is to make world-class active experiences available right here in Mohali, setting the stage for our next phase of expansion.” Adding to this, Anngad Sabharwal, Marketing Head, SkyJumper India, shared, “With 22 centres across India, we are just getting started.”
